Re: Another calla lily question:
Im pretty sure the colors vary depending upon the crop. Just ask your florist about the possibilities of not getting exactly what you want. It would $uck to do a whole color scheme on mauve and end up with bright pink or orange.I think the first photo is a mix of mauve and mango while the second boquet is all mauve.
I had the black beauties and they did look quite dark in the B/W but that didnt bother me. They were so gorgeous in person.
